@media screen and (max-width:1200px){
	.pc{display: none;}
	.wap{display: block;}
	.sanxian{display: block;}
	.top1c{max-width: 94%;}
	.top2{padding: 10px 0;}
	.top2c{width: 100%;}
	.top2 .logo{width: 60%; float: none;}
	.top2c{height: auto;}
	.top2c form{display: none;}
	.top1c2{display: none;}
	.nav{display: none;}
	.main{max-width: 94%; padding: 20px 0;}
	.m1left{width: 100%; float: none;}
	.m1left .pic{width: 100%; margin-right: 0; float: none; margin-bottom: 10px;}
	.m1left1{height: auto;}
	.m1left1 p{height: 75px; overflow: hidden;
		display: -webkit-box;
		-webkit-box-orient: vertical;
		-webkit-line-clamp: 3;
	}
	.m1left2{padding: 15px 0;}
	.m1left2 li{width: 100%; float: none; overflow: hidden;}
	.m1left2 li:nth-child(2n+1){float: none;}
	.m1left2 li a{width: 70%; display: inline-block; white-space: nowrap; text-overflow: ellipsis; overflow: hidden;}
	.m1left2 li span{display: inline-block; width: 30%; text-align: right;}
	.m1left3c li a{width: 70%; display: inline-block; white-space: nowrap; text-overflow: ellipsis; overflow: hidden;}
	.m1left3c li span{display: inline-block; width: 25%; text-align: right;}
	.m1right{width: 100%; float: none; margin-top: 20px;}
	.m1right li{width: 48%; margin: 0 1%; margin-top: 10px;}
	.m1right .bt{margin-bottom: 10px;}

	#slide{display: none;}



	.footc{width: 94%; padding: 15px 2%;}
	.ad{height: 100px; background-size: 100% 100%;}
	.nei{max-width: 94%; margin: auto;}
	.neileft{width: 100%; float: none; margin-bottom: 0px;}
	.neit{margin-top: 15px;}
	.neiright{width: 100%; float: none;}
	.weizhi{margin-top: 0px; font-size: 20px;}
	.linklist ul li{height: 30px; line-height: 30px;}
	.linklist ul li a{display: inline-block; width: 70%; white-space: nowrap; text-overflow: ellipsis; overflow: hidden;}
	.biaoti{padding-top: 15px;}
	.content{text-align: justify; padding: 15px 0; overflow: hidden;}
	.huozhenglist{padding: 15px 0;}
	.huozhenglist ul li{width: 46%; margin: 2%; height: auto;}
	.huozhenglist ul li:nth-child(4n+1){margin-left: 0px;}
	.huozhenglist ul li div{height: 120px;}
	.huozhenglist ul li p{line-height: 20px;}


	.wapnav{
		width:100%; background-color:#F8F8F8; height:auto; display:none;
	}
	.wapnav li{
		padding:0px; font-size:16px; color:#777777;
	}
	.wapnav li a{
		color:#777777;
	}
	.wapnav dl{
		padding-left:30px; border-bottom:1px solid #E7E7E7; display:none;
	}
	.wapnav dl dd{
		line-height:35px; font-size:14px;
	}
	.wapnav span{
		 display:block; line-height:40px; padding-left:10px; border-bottom:1px dashed #E7E7E7;
	}
	.wapnav .navmoon{
		 background-color:#E6E6E6;
	}
	.sanxian{
		position: absolute; right: 10px; top: 55px; display: block;
	}
	.wenjianlist ul li span{display: inline-block; width: 70%; overflow: hidden; white-space: nowrap; text-overflow: ellipsis;}
	#pages{padding-bottom: 20px;}
	.wenjianlist{padding-bottom: 20px;}
	.chaxun p span{width: 30%;}
	.chaxun p{width: 100%;}
	.chatext{width: 58%; padding: 0 4%;}
	.chasel{width: 66%;}
	.chabut{margin-left: 30%;}

	.renkelist ul li{width: 46%; margin: 2%; height: auto;}
	.renkelist ul li:nth-child(4n+1){margin-left: 1%;}
	.zhengshulist ul li{width: 46%; margin: 2%; height: auto;}
	.zhengshulist ul li:nth-child(4n+1){margin-left: 1%;}
	.zhengshulist ul li div{height: 190px;}

	.m2{padding-bottom: 0px;}
	.m2 .huozhenglist{padding: 0px;}

	.wnav{
		background-color: #0161B9; display: flex; justify-content: space-between; flex-wrap: wrap;
	}
	.wnav a{
		display: flex; width: 25%; color: #fff; text-align: center; justify-content: center; align-items: center; line-height: 35px; float: left; margin-left: -1px;
	}
	.wnav a:nth-child(1){border-right: 1px solid #fff;border-bottom: 1px solid #fff;}
	.wnav a:nth-child(2){border-right: 1px solid #fff;border-bottom: 1px solid #fff;}
	.wnav a:nth-child(3){border-right: 1px solid #fff;border-bottom: 1px solid #fff;}
	.wnav a:nth-child(4){border-bottom: 1px solid #fff;}
	.wnav a:nth-child(5){border-right: 1px solid #fff;}
	.wnav a:nth-child(6){border-right: 1px solid #fff;}
	.wnav a:nth-child(7){border-right: 1px solid #fff;}
}